However, be warned. A new HDTV is the whole equation.First, you will need a high-definition cable or satellite box. This sends the HD channels to your television; without one, you can only watch standard programming. Second, you will need high-def channels. Your cable or satellite provider offers a line-up of HD channels, though the number of available HD channels is nowhere close the number of available standard channels. Third, you will need an HD show or movie. Not all shows broadcast on an HD station are necessarily high-definition; news programs are often broadcast in standard-definition, as are most daytime programs. If you are watching a standard-def show, you may see a black bar on either side of the screen. Also, since you are watching a standard-def show on a high-def screen, the picture will not be nearly as clear or as sharp as with an HD program. Only when you have all three elements - an HD box, channel and show - can you experience television like never before.

If you walk into your local fishing shop, you are likely to find
a wide range of fishing gear. For the beginner, it can be hard
to determine just what is out there and what you should be
purchasing. While you may want to purchase products and gear
that are specific to your tastes, it is much more important to
purchase products that are of high quality instead. So, what do
you look for and how do you know what to get? To know, here are
some guidelines you should follow.
* First, determine what type of fish, what type of fishing and
where you are headed to fish. Fishing gear is specific first to
the type of fishing that you plan to do. You’ll need a different
fishing rod for saltwater fishing than you will for freshwater
fishing. Now, on to what type of fish you are after. You’ll need
to know what weight of line you should purchase as well. You may
need a heavier line if you are heading out for King Salmon
rather than the small trout in your local pond. And, when it
comes to the area, you’ll also need to know what the fish like.
Some lures work on fish better than others. You can find this
out by talking to the local fishing tackle employee. * How much
to purchase depends on what you plan to invest. The more that
you purchase, though does nothing to make you a better
fisherman. What you need is to insure that you get quality
products that will withstand your adventure. Quality is always
necessary. * For the beginner, knowledge is also the key to
success. If you haven’t been out there just yet, you should take
along an experienced individual to help you. That way you get
the best results and you get the education you need to do it on
your own next time.
